Key features & specifications
- Total output: 22kW (NG); groups of high-efficiency tube burners with radiant deflectors
- Fuel options: Natural Gas (NG) or ULPG
- Temperature: Surface up to ~400°C for rapid sealing
- Dimensions (W×D×H): 800 × 930 × 850 mm
- Construction: 2mm AISI 304 stainless top; reversible cast-iron grills; 130mm SS splash guard; enamelled cast-iron flue protector
- Grease management: Opening to 12L collection tray
- Ignition & power: Electric multispark ignition, 0.10kW, 230V 1N
- Water rating: IPX5
- Gas connection: R3/4″
- Serviceability: Components accessible from the front
- Warranty: 2 years parts & labour + 2 years parts only on registration
Compliance & safety (AU)
- Gas: Install/commission by a licensed gas fitter per AS/NZS 5601.1; size pipework/regulators for total demand.
- Electrical: RCM compliant (for ignition); use a dedicated circuit per site spec.
Convenience & usage advice
- Grate selection: Use ridged side for steaks/burgers; flip to flat side for fish/veg and easy pan work.
- Grease routine: Empty/clean the 12L tray daily; scrape grates hot, then oil lightly to prevent sticking.

Frequently Asked Questions
1) How do I clean it daily without harming finishes?
While hot, scrape grates with a grill brick/scraper; avoid harsh abrasives; wipe stainless with pH-neutral degreaser and dry.
2) What routine maintenance keeps performance stable?
Weekly: clear burner ports and check flame patterns; Monthly: inspect splash guards and flue protector; Quarterly: tech safety check.
3) What are the gas/electrical requirements and typical energy use?
Gas load 22kW; size supply per fitter’s calculation; ignition 0.10kW on 230V 1N; actual gas use varies by duty cycle.
4) What about installation and Australian compliance?
Install per AS/NZS 5601.1 with correct clearances/ventilation; RCM for electrical components; follow site safety policies.
5) Are spare parts and accessories available?
Common parts include grates, splash guards, ignitors and knobs; quote model/serial to source exact components.
